If you’re looking for an authentic experience in South Finistère, don’t miss a trip to the market. A veritable treasure trove of local culture, summer markets and night markets are held daily in various communes, offering a unique opportunity to discover local produce while enjoying the friendly atmosphere.

Night markets in South Finistère
- Mondays in Lesconil (6-9pm)
- Tuesdays at Port La Forêt (a stone’s throw from the campsite) from 6 p.m.
- Wednesdays in Ergué Gabéric, near the Kerdevot chapel, with concerts and entertainment (from 5 to 8 pm) and in Pouldreuzic (from 5 to 8 pm).
- Thursday: star market in Locronan (from 5pm)
- Sunday in Clohars Carnoët (non-food market, combined with Sorties de bains, live shows and storytelling evenings)
